Hotels Near By The Nook Londons Swanky Studio with FREE Parking
Central London - Zone 1
Waterloo and Southwark
Central London - Zone 1
Central London - Zone 1
Central London - Zone 1
Central London - Zone 1
Central London - Zone 1
Central London - Zone 1
Waterloo and Southwark
Waterloo and Southwark
Central London - Zone 1
Central London - Zone 1
Central London - Zone 1
Central London - Zone 1
Central London